I need a new wireless router. My current one has got to be 7+ years old and seems to drop the signal about as much as it carries it. Any suggestions on brand? What am I looking for?

You might just want to reposition it or make the paper/aluminum foil antenna .

http://www.instructables.com/id/DIY-WIF ... n-Booster/

Dual N is the fastest available, but it has to be Dual N at both ends, router and pc.

http://reviews.cnet.com/best-wireless-n ... ell;rb_mtx

Recently, I've been looking at streaming video boxes and most use the N routers.
